Hearty Kenyan Nyama Choma with Kachumbari Salad

Nyama Choma, meaning "roasted meat" in Swahili, is a popular East African dish. It's perfectly complemented by Kachumbari, a fresh tomato and onion salad.

Preparation

Get these tasks done before you start cooking.

Marinating the Meat

  1. 1

    Combine ingredients

    In a large bowl, combine garlic, ginger, olive oil, salt, pepper, and lemon juice.

  2. 2

    Coat the meat

    Add the meat and toss until well-coated.

  3. 3

    Refrigerate

    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our or overnight for best results.

Preparing the Kachumbari

  1. 1

    Mix vegetables

    In a medium bowl, mix tomatoes, red onion, cucumber, and cilantro.

  2. 2

    Season salad

    Add lime juice, salt, and pepper to taste.

  3. 3

    Toss and rest

    Toss gently and set aside for flavors to blend.

How to Make Hearty Kenyan Nyama Choma with Kachumbari Salad

Total time: 2 h · Yields 4 servings

  1. 1

    Grill the Meat

    Place marinated meat chunks on the grill, turning occasionally until evenly cooked and slightly charred.

  2. 2

    Mix the Salad

    Just before serving, give the Kachumbari a final toss, adjusting seasoning if necessary.

  3. 3

    Rest the Meat

    Allow grilled meat to rest for 5 minutes before serving.
